123

yiwer007 发布于 2025-02-15 39 次阅读


单击 “编辑” 按钮更改此文本。这是测试文本。

				
					console.log( 'Code is Poetry' );
				
			
Tips:

1.要理解栈的先入后出(LIFO)的特性。

2.分析给定的输入序列,观察元素的顺序以及它们在栈中的入栈和出栈顺序。

3.根据 LIFO 特性,确定栈的输出序列应该是输入序列的逆序。

4.进一步思考,找出一个不可能的输出序列,可以通过观察输入序列中元素的顺序和它们在栈中的出栈顺序来推理。

5.注意观察和分析问题,运用逻辑推理和对栈的特性的理解来解决问题。
Tips:

1.让学生理解栈的后进先出(LIFO)特性以及栈的基本操作(入栈和出栈)。

2.强调学生需要注意输入序列的顺序以及栈中元素的入栈和出栈顺序。

3.输出序列的第一个元素是 n,意味着 n 是最后一个入栈的元素,应该首先出栈。

4.输出序列的第 k 个元素可以通过计算 n - k + 1 得到。这是因为第 k 个元素与 n 的位置差为 k - 1,所以它在栈中的位置是 n - (k - 1) = n - k + 1。

5.在计算时要注意边界情况,确保 k 的取值范围在 1 到 n 之间。
Tips:

1.思考栈的定义

2.思考栈的初始化
Tips:

1.思考栈的定义

2.思考栈的初始化

3.入栈过程中的一个必要前提

在这里添加您的标题文本

此作者没有提供个人介绍
最后更新于 2025-02-15